Hey gang. I've been watching one of my client sites since the so called "Florida" update to Google and wanted some opinions if anyone has them to offer. I have a site - http://www.grandslamkw.com - which used to be about 37 on Google for the term "Key West Fishing". Now it is over 400! I have watched it since the big upsetting change in the algorithms and it has slowly crept from 500+ to 427 or 208 depending on if you use quotes in your search or not. I have added more relevant content, cleaned it up, gotten the Google Page Rank from 4/10 to 5/10 and even cleaned up some of the Alt tags that could have been considered spamming just in case. My problem is that using Google, no one will ever see my client's site and go fishing. No fishing - no money. No money - no web designer (that's me!) If anyone has something to try then I'm all ears. I've been watching it creep around but not do anything significant and 200+ is still way too far down. By the way, another thing I noticed just for fun. In the Google Directory section it is still showing this site as what looks like a PR of 3/10 with a very old page title. Another fun thing I noticed is that another site of mine ranks 0/10 with **** and 4/10 with www.**** Not sure if that helps anyone but I thought it interesting nonetheless. Thanks gang!

My current knowledge of computer tech and my prior interest in the cypherpunks privacy group makes me knee-jerk say "Aaaiiieeee" (you can quote me on that ) My older and more calm self says "Does it really matter?" We could drive ourselves into a secluded cabin in the mountains with ammo and canned spam for the next 30 years if we think about it. For instance, how hard would it be for the grocery store, in cooperation with your bank, to take everything you buy at the store and send across their computerized barcoded scanners and tie that to your credit card getting your name, address, etc and then report to Gillette that you used to buy a pack of razors every week but now you stopped so you must have bought an electric razor and they better get on the ball if they want you back as a customer? Before you know it you are innundated with Mach III razor ads and coupons in your mailbox. I am not refuting your concern by any means! Don't take this wrong! I'm just wondering out loud if it really matters much that Ford knows user 33x324.2 just came from the Chevy site? The worst that could happen from anon tracking is in-your-face ads and popup blockers, etc help with that. If they tie your name to it then it's a bit more iffy, but I have spam blockers and popup blockers and if Ford wants to spend $0.20 to send me a brochure of their latest super truck then let 'em.
